植物乙醇提取物对三化螟控制作用研究

摘    要:研究了30种植物乙醇提取物对三化螟Scirpophaga incertulas(Walker)的产卵驱避效果,并用产卵驱避率及干扰作用控制指数(IIPC)对这些效果进行评价.结果表明,处理后48 h,10种植物乙醇提取物对三化螟产卵有显著的驱避作用,其中海芋Alocasia macrorrhiza产卵驱避率最高,达到82.79%,蜜柚Citrus grandis、三叶鬼针草Bidenspilosa、马蔸铃Aristolo chiachampionii、白蝴蝶Syngonium podophyllum 4种植物的产卵驱避率为75%以上,llPC低于0.13.非选择性的试验结果同样表明海芋和屿蔸铃的乙醇提取物对三化螟具有明显的产卵驱避作用.测定结果还表明,海芋乙醇提取物处理后三化螟初孵幼虫的钻人时间是对照的2.60倍,马蔸铃是对照的1.07倍;海芋乙醇提取物处理后三化螟的钻蛀率为40%,马蔸铃乙醇提取物则为58%,两者都明显低于对照钻蛀率98.33%.此外,海芋乙醇提取物对二化螟幼虫存活率的影响不明显,但是马蔸铃乙醇提取物对幼虫存活率的影响与对照相比差异显著.

Studies on the control efficacy of the plant alcohol extracts on the yellow stem borer, Scirpophaga incertulas

Abstract:The oviposition repellent effect on the yellow stem borer (YSB) , Scirpophaga incertulas of alcohol extracts from 30 plant species was tested in laboratory and the oviposition repellent rate and UPC were used to evaluate the repellent effect. The results showed that the extracts from 10 plant species had significant oviposition repellent effect in 48 hours after treatment. The extracts from Alocasia macrorrhiza, Citrus grandis, Bidens pilosa, Aristolo chiachampionii and Syngonium podophyllum had the significant effects with more than 75% of ovipositoion repellent and less than 0. 13 of IIPC.Non - choice test also showed the same result that the extracts of the two plants of Alocasia macrorrhiza and Aristolo chiachampionii showed significant oviposition repellency effect on YSB. Furthermore, the boring time - spent and boring rate of larvae were determined in the laboratory, the results showed the boring time - spent under extracts treatments of the two plant species, namely the Alocasia macrorrhiza and Aristolo chiachampionii, were 2. 60 and 1. 07 times respectively of the control, and the boring rate was 40% and 58% respectively, significantly less than the control with a boring rate of 98. 33%. The extract of Alocasia macrorrhiza did not show significant effect on the larval survival rate of YSB; while the extract of Aristolo chiachampionii caused the larval survival rate reduce significantly.
